Picking the Incorrect Paint Shade



Selecting the proper paint color is a critical choice when repainting your insides, as it establishes the tone and atmosphere of the area. One usual error to stay clear of is choosing the wrong paint color. The shade you pick can significantly influence the total look of a space.

For instance, selecting dark colors in a little area can make it really feel cramped and dismal, while picking extremely bright shades may lead to a space that really feels overwhelming and distracting.

To prevent this error, think about factors such as the space's all-natural light, the feature of the space, and the mood you want to develop. It's also essential to examine paint examples on the walls before committing to a color to see how it looks in different illumination problems throughout the day.

Neglecting Correct Surface Preparation



When repainting your interiors, neglecting proper surface area preparation can cause unacceptable outcomes and reduce the long life of the paint task. Among the most vital action in achieving a professional-looking coating is making certain that the surface areas to be painted are tidy, smooth, and correctly topped.

Ignoring to clean the wall surfaces completely before paint can cause attachment issues, where the paint falls short to correctly stick to the surface area. Dust, dirt, and grease can stop the paint from sticking equally, leading to peeling or flaking in time.

In addition, stopping working to resolve flaws such as splits, holes, or irregular textures can cause the problems to reveal via the paint, detracting from the overall look of the space.

Properly priming the surfaces before paint is likewise necessary, as it assists the paint stick much better, advertises even insurance coverage, and can prevent stains or discoloration from hemorrhaging with.

Taking the time to prepare the surfaces properly will eventually guarantee an expert and long-lasting paint job.

Rushing Via the Paint Refine



Hastily progressing via the painting process can compromise the high quality and sturdiness of the result. Hurrying can bring about several problems, such as uneven protection, noticeable brush strokes, paint drips, and missed out on areas. Each of these problems interferes with the general aesthetic allure of the area and can be time-consuming to remedy.



When painting, it's essential to allow adequate time for each and every layer to completely dry before using the following one. Failing to do so can lead to the paint not sticking appropriately, causing peeling or flaking over time.
